Type
ORACLE
Validation date
2025-04-19 00:43: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.978e-4,
    "usd": 3.387e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000105951CA81AB4CEA1163D702D49836D4F88AF363BD62F815776AD4A4683EF714D

Previous signature

3DF15AEE08CDF1579412EA95A3C0623D0D1CAD849765B46792DE438A8016D6BBE38E5B11D4A8A4B452102999540A97637A65E43BD927DB4940895079D1862304

Origin signature

3045022100823F88610A2EE1DBC5AF9AEDEC2E9F0BE0A92CD7CB362A7F7760B54C6DB861CE02206D15FFF67FBF99C26493AD5B8BB5ADCADA53E8972C9A09D01D0B8CE3EE3F3BC6

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

007252F6E423B4561E6BCAC5AEC51ECA58187EDEA29DA273BD2BB07CF4ADB040CE

Coordinator signature

53D2DC8C3524D7906565007A35097DBD295E763F1F15D0481C58CA1CC54D8667306AA5861FD43EB9B2AFA01677ADF60ECFD80472152363C62D97E6F5756B9D09

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

E53F831A5BD6F826EAF53468E798D270E33B0E38EEBA75EA3026A39F525BF3BC3E9585AE31A71D7EB4858A890CCFA79FD72AFCA266947C91BE9F6EEC7995F705

Validator #2 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#2 signature

F5C554ECB229A18031B9307F108D6C8664242CC4464364D4D46733079D660B0D174F552B60B2AD30BCFA083A56931850EEAD8A1253314AD804E76F3FB9AA710C